WebFeb 7, 2024 · HAP features load calculation and system sizing for commercial buildings plus hourly energy modeling. Thermal loads are calculated using the ASHRAE® Transfer Function load method. System components are sized using the System-Based Design concept, which applies the ASHRAE Heat Extraction Methodology to link system …

WebAug 18, 2005 · I have also used HAP extensively. You can "schedule" various internal loads like lighting, occupancy, etc., in the program to get a far more accurate results than the instantaneous heat load which is calculated the traditional way of Q = U A Delta T. Also, HAP calculates 8760 hours in a year - i.e. 365 days x 24 hours a day.
